The Role of Artificial Intelligence in Cryptocurrency Security
The emergence of cryptocurrency has revolutionized the financial landscape, creating new opportunities and challenges. One of the most pressing concerns surrounding cryptocurrencies is security. With the rise of cyber threats, maintaining the integrity of digital currencies is paramount. This is where Artificial Intelligence (AI) comes into play, serving as a powerful tool to enhance cryptocurrency security.
AI technology utilizes advanced algorithms and machine learning techniques to analyze vast amounts of data. This capability enables AI systems to detect unusual patterns and behaviors associated with potential security breaches. By applying AI in cryptocurrency security, businesses can proactively identify and address threats before they escalate.
One of the primary applications of AI in cryptocurrency security is in fraud detection. Traditional methods often struggle to keep pace with rapidly evolving hacking techniques. However, AI can analyze transaction patterns across different platforms, identifying anomalies that may indicate fraudulent activities. By implementing machine learning models, cryptocurrency exchanges can enhance their fraud detection capabilities, minimizing losses and protecting users.
Moreover, AI can improve the process of identity verification. In the cryptocurrency world, verifying user identities is crucial to prevent unauthorized access and potential theft. AI-powered biometric systems, such as facial recognition or fingerprint scanning, offer a reliable solution for ensuring that only legitimate users gain access to their accounts. This increased layer of security helps in maintaining trust among users and stakeholders.
Another significant advantage of AI in this field is its role in smart contract security. Smart contracts are self-executing contracts with the terms of the agreement directly written into code. However, these contracts can be vulnerable to bugs and security flaws. AI can analyze smart contracts for potential vulnerabilities, ensuring that any loopholes are identified and rectified before deployment. This process significantly reduces the risk of exploitation.
AI also plays a crucial role in threat intelligence. With the cryptocurrency market constantly evolving, staying informed about potential threats is vital. AI systems can sift through massive amounts of data from various sources, including forums, social media, and dark web activities. By gathering and analyzing this information, AI can provide insights into emerging threats, allowing cryptocurrency businesses to take preventative measures.
Although the potential of AI in cryptocurrency security is enormous, it's essential to approach its implementation with caution. Over-reliance on AI systems may lead to vulnerabilities if not appropriately managed. Organizations must ensure they have a balanced approach, integrating AI technology with human oversight to maximize its effectiveness.
